Those seeking a job in the federal government will now have to write an essay in support of Donald Trump’s executive orders, according to a memo from the Office of Personnel Management.
Vince Haley, the White House’s head of domestic policy, wrote in the May 29 memorandum that all civil service applicants must answer a series of essays as part of the job recruitment process, including one about how they would “help advance” Trump’s policy priorities.
